HarperCollins Children's Books has announced the introduction of a fiction contest in the name of Ursula Nordstrom, the legendary children's publisher who directed Harper's Department of Books for Boys and Girls from 1940 to 1973. The contest will be open to U.S. writers who have not been published before. The winner of the contest will receive a hardcover book contract with a $7,500 advance as well as a $1,500 cash award. Submissions will be accepted from March 15 through April 15, and the winner will be announced on June 15.
